Synopsis

They were two young women, strikingly similar in life…strikingly similar in death. Both strangled with their own scarves— one in Devon, one outside of a fashionable Mayfair pub called I Am the Only Running Footman. Richard Jury teams up with Devon’s irascible local divisional commander, Brian Macalvie, to solve the murders. With nothing to tie the women together but the fatal scarves, Jury pursues his only suspect…and a trail of tragedy that just might lead to yet another victim. And her killer…

Rubbing
Abrasion or wear to the surface. Usually used in reference to a book's boards or dust-jacket.
